
BTA TV is what happens when a country's music scene gets its own 24/7 video channel, and Venezuela's scene is chaotic, colorful, and loud. The playlist leans heavy on reggaeton and Latin pop, but you'll also get salsa dura, traditional folk, and the occasional rock en español deep cut. It's not curated for international audiences; this is Venezuelan programming, through and through. The music video blocks run for hours without interruption, which makes it perfect background noise for a party or a long afternoon. Production values are inconsistent, some videos look like they cost a nickel, others are slick Miami-budget clips. The on-air branding feels early-2000s: big animated logos, flashy transitions, a countdown clock that seems to reset randomly. But that's part of the charm. Hosts appear briefly between blocks, speaking fast Caracas slang that's tough even for other Spanish speakers to follow.
